Raspberry Pi 5 Kit
Compact Raspberry Pi 5 starter kit with 8GB RAM, aluminum case, active cooling, and a preloaded OS. Ideal for hobbyists, lightweight desktop tasks, and media playback — excellent for those who want a low-cost, energy-efficient barebones alternative.
Why this budget pick works
The iRasptek Raspberry Pi 5 Starter Kit pairs a high-performance Pi 5 (8GB LPDDR4X) with a metal case, active cooling, and a 27W USB-C power supply — everything you need to run a responsive desktop or compact media box. In testing the Pi 5 handled 4K video playback, light web browsing, and coding workloads admirably, while the aluminum case and PWM fan kept thermals reasonable under sustained load.
Pros:
- Extremely low power draw and cost-effective
- Good out-of-the-box accessories (case, power, cooler)
- Great for learning, DIY, and small home servers
Cons:
- Not a drop-in replacement for x86 desktop apps (ARM architecture)
- Limited GPU/CPU ceiling for heavy editing or gaming
Who should buy: hobbyists, educators, and anyone who needs a tiny, inexpensive desktop or edge device and is comfortable with ARM-based software.
ASUS NUC 14 Essential
Compact barebone mini-PC designed for office productivity with efficient Intel N-series processors, VESA mount, and triple-display support. A practical choice for schools, kiosks, and minimalist desktops where low power and quiet operation matter.
Balanced performance and practicality
The ASUS NUC 14 Essential Barebone hits a sweet spot for cost-conscious users who still need a capable small-form-factor PC. Its focus is energy-efficient Intel N150-class processors with support for DDR5 through a single SO‑DIMM slot and easy-to-access internals. The chassis supports triple displays, has plentiful I/O, and is designed for quick upgrades — perfect for digital signage, home offices, and light content tasks.
Pros:
- Very affordable for a branded mini-PC platform
- Quiet, energy-efficient operation and good port selection
- Tool-less access and VESA compatibility simplify deployment
Cons:
- Single RAM slot limits upgrade flexibility compared to dual-channel designs
- Not intended for heavy compute workloads
Who should buy: small-business deployments, educators, and users who want a compact, dependable daily-driver that’s budget-friendly without sacrificing modern connectivity.
ASRock DeskMini X600
Ultra-compact 1.92L barebone supporting AM5 Ryzen APUs, DDR5 SODIMM, USB4 and PCIe Gen5 M.2. Excellent for users who need a powerful, highly upgradable small PC for productivity, light content creation, and home labs.
Our top pick: compact power and expandability
The ASRock DeskMini X600 is the most capable and flexible mini barebone in this group. Despite its tiny 1.92L footprint, it supports AM5 Ryzen 7000/8000/9000-series APUs (up to 65W TDP), DDR5 SO‑DIMMs, USB4 (DisplayPort Alt Mode), and both PCIe Gen5 and Gen4 M.2 slots — giving a surprising capacity for CPU, memory, and storage. Cooling is optimized for such a compact chassis, and ASRock’s integrated power adapter simplifies setup.
Pros:
- Exceptional upgrade path and modern platform support (DDR5, PCIe Gen5)
- Triple-display outputs and robust I/O including USB4
- Small footprint with meaningful desktop-class performance
Cons:
- Requires compatible AM5 APU and SO‑DIMM DDR5 memory (sold separately)
- Thermal management can require attention if you push high TDP parts
Who should buy: enthusiasts and professionals wanting a tiny, upgradeable desktop that can be scaled from efficient office use to substantially more demanding tasks without moving to a full tower.
ASUS NUC 14 Pro
High-end NUC tall barebone with 14th Gen Intel Core Ultra processor support, triple storage, Thunderbolt 4, and advanced AI/NPU features. Ideal for creators and professionals who need strong single-threaded and AI-accelerated performance in a compact chassis.
Premium performance in a compact chassis
The ASUS NUC 14 Pro Tall is aimed at users who want near-laptop-class performance in a compact desktop. It supports Intel 14th Gen Core Ultra processors with integrated Intel Arc graphics, NPU acceleration for AI workloads, triple-drive storage options, Thunderbolt 4, and generous RAM capacity (up to 96GB DDR5). The toolless chassis and advanced cooling make upgrades straightforward — perfect for content creators, developers, and power users constrained by space.
Pros:
- Leading-edge CPU/GPU/NPU support for mixed workloads
- Thunderbolt 4 and multiple storage/PCIe options
- Toolless access and strong connectivity (Wi‑Fi 6E, Bluetooth)
Cons:
- Higher price than simpler NUC models or SBC kits
- Overkill for very light daily tasks where a cheaper model suffices
Who should buy: professionals and creators who need strong performance, AI acceleration, and high expandability in a small footprint and are willing to pay a premium for it.
